Tension control Bolts (TC Bolts) are specialized fasteners mainly utilized in steel frame construction. They include a pre-assembled bolt, nut, and washer for simplified installation. In contrast to standard Bolts, TC Bolts have a domed head and a distinctive spline design that enables accurate tensioning during the installation process. This advancement has led to their growing popularity in the construction sector because of their effectiveness and dependability. In this article, examined this type of Bolts, installation mechanism, their advantages over conventional high-strength structural Bolts, challenges and considerations, durability comparison between traditional and TC Bolts, design features, installation process, and also review the relevant standards associated with them.

متاستاز استخوان یکی از عوارض مهم و ناتوان کننده بیماریهای بدخیم به شمار می رود از آنجائیکه طول عمر نسبی بیماران مبتلا به متاستاز استخوان عموما زیاد است، تشخیص سریع و به موقع این ضایعات می تواند سبب بهبود کمی و کیفی زندگی بیمار شده و از پیشرفت کنترل نشده بیماری و بروز عوامل ناتوان کننده پیشگیری کند.در این مطالعه 22 بیمار مبتلا به سرطان بدخیم اولیه (با تشخیص های مختلف) و علائم و نشانه های متاستاز در دو نوبت مورد ارزیابی قرار گرفتند. بیماران انتخاب شده یکی از پاتولوژیهای زیر را داشته اند:Small Round Cell Tumor، کانسر پستان، کانسر پروستات، کانسر نازوفارنکس و مولتیپل میلوم. ابتدا اسکن استخوان به وسیله 99m Tc-MDP به عمل می آمد و بلافاصله یک هفته بعد اسکن کامل بدن با 99m Tc-MIBI تکرار می شد (در این فاصله هیچ درمانی برای بیماران انجام نمی شد). تعداد مناطق جذب و نیز شدت جذب ضایعات در اسکن 99m Tc-MIBI به صورت کیفی و نیز کمی ارزیابی شده و با اسکن استخوان مورد مقایسه قرار می گرفت. بعد از مقایسه نتایج، مشخص گردید اسکن تمام بدن با 99m Tc-MIBI تنها در 14 نفر از 22 نفر مثبت شده، و در این بیماران در مجموع 44.4% تعداد کل ضایعات استخوانی کشف شده در استخوان با 99m Tc-MDP را نشان داده است (24 ضایعه از 54 ضایعه) که میانگین شدت جذب آن نیز حدود +1.5 (خفیف تا متوسط) بود ولی در عوض در 7 تن از بیماران که دارای اسکن مثبت بودند بعضی از ضایعات پنهان بافت نرم را نیز عمدتا در نواحی گره های لنفاوی با میانگین شدت 20 (متوسط) به تصویر کشید. بنابراین به نظر می رسد در بررسی متاستازهای استخوانی، اسکن استخوان با 99m Tc-MDP در مقایسه با اسکن 99m Tc-MIBI  یافته های بیشتری را نشان می دهد، در حالیکه اهمیت اسکن 99m Tc-MIBI عمدتا در کشف ضایعات بافت نرم است.

Introduction: The aim of this study was to develop an optimized formulation for labeling a third-generation bisphosphonate, zoledronic acid with [99mTc] Tc to achieve the best formulation in preparing an ideal skeletal radiotracer. Radiocomplex yield and purity, stability, biodistribution and imaging in normal rat were investigated. Methods: The samples containing different amounts of zoledronic acid, ascorbic acid and stannous chloride were prepared and labeled with [ 99m Tc]technetium pertechnetate. TLC methods were used to determine the radiochemical purity. The stability was determined in saline and human serum solutions. Lipophilicity was calculated by measuring radio-complex that was divided between organic and aqueous phases. In vitro bone affinity was studied through hydroxyapatite binding assays. Considering the decomposition of radioactivity, biodistribution of radio-complex was assessed based on the percentage of injected activity per gram of organ (% IA/g). Results: [99mTc]Tc-zoledronic acid was prepared easily with high yield while 100 µ, g, 0. 34 µ, mol of zoledronic acid as a ligand and 100 µ, g, 0. 44 µ, mol SnCl2 as a reducing agent were used. Radiochemical purity of radio-complex was more than 99% with specific activity of 8050 MBq/µ, mol. The radio-complex showed rapid blood washout along with high bone uptake value (4. 53 ±,0. 14 % IA/g at 2 h post injection). Conclusion: Under optimized condition, [99mTc]Tc-zoledronic acid was prepared with high purity and stability together with high bone affinity and rapid blood clearance, make this radio-complex an ideal agent with great potential for skeletal imaging.

Objectives: 99mTc-MAG3 is a standard radiotracer for renal dynamic functional study. Despite its properties for clinical uses, it has numerous technical limitations. 99mTc-EC is also a tubular radiotracer for renal imaging, which has not been used worldwide. In this study, the use of 99mTc-EC and 99mTc-MAG3 for renal functional study were compared.Methods: Thirty five patients (20 male, 15 female; mean age of 34.63 ±10.69 years) were entered in the study. About 10 mCi of 99mTc-EC and 99mTc-MAG3 were administered in different days within 7 days intervals and serial images were obtained for 30 minutes. Serum creatinine and visual scintigraphic findings of all patients were within normal limits.Results: In this study, the renal uptake of 99mTc-EC was significantly higher than 99mTc-MAG3 (6.20% vs 4.39% of the injected dose), while the hepatic activity of 99mTc-EC was significantly lower (307 vs 439 mean pixel count, p<0.0001). Also the absolute values for some other quantitative parameters such as right and left kidney transit times and ERPF were different for each radiotracer. In spite of these differences most quantitative parameters (except for right kidney transit time, liver uptake and Tmax of both kidneys) showed good correlations for both agents.Conclusion: The calculated ERPF with 99mTc-EC as compared to 99mTc-MAG3 is in closer proximity to the true values. Also the use of 99mTc-EC compared to 99mTc-MAG3 in clinic due to simplicity of preparation, higher stability, higher renal uptake, and lower hepatobiliary activity is better. Therefore the use of 99mTc-EC as an appropriate substitute or ever preferred radiopharmaceutical for 99mTc-MAG3 radiopharmaceutical for renal function studies is recommended.

Introduction: For renal scintigraphy, different radiopharmaceuticals like 99mTc-DMSA and 99mTc-EC can be used. Although these methods are accurate, some differences can be observed among them. These radiopharmaceuticals have different levels of reproducibility and repeatability. This study aimed to evaluate the level of inter and intra observer variability in 99mTc-DMSA scintigraphy. We also compared the renal function, measured with 99mTc-EC, with the one measured using 99mTc-DMSA scintigraphy to determine if 99mTc-EC can be used instead of 99mTc-DMSA in this regard.Methods: The sample volume consisted of 81 patients underwent both 99mTc-DMSA and 99mTc-EC in Imam Reza Health Center in 2008. These scans were interpreted by two observers. One of the observers interpreted the scans after one month for the second time. The data were analyzed with SPSS.Results: There was a close correlation between these two methods with respect to DRF (P = 0.51). Estimating intra observer variability showed close correlation between DMSA (r = 0.997) and EC (r = 0.996). The evaluation of inter observer variability also revealed high correlation between DMSA (r = 0.995) and EC (r = 0.996).Conclusion: Since the comparison between these two methods in measuring renal function showed the same results, 99mTc-EC can be used as a substitute for 99mTc-DMSA. In addition, Tc-99m EC scintigraphy can be a reliable single-modality study to evaluate renal cortical defects, perfusion, and drainage of the urinary system and indirect evidence of vesicoureteric reflux with the added advantage of low radiation exposure to the patient. Also good reproducibility and repeatability were reported according to this study.

In this study, the failure analysis of base plate Bolts of radial forging machine is investigated. Premature failure had occurred from the Bolts shank-head fillet and threads zones. Hardness, impact and tensile tests are carried out to investigate the mechanical properties and spectrophotometer is used to evaluate the Bolts chemical composition. Optical Microscope (OM) and Scanning Electron Microscope (SEM) are used for the investigation of microstructure, defects, fracture surface and failure causes. The fracture surface morphology shows that the crack growth consisted of Bolts shank-head fillet and threads zones including the initiation zone, fatigue crack growth zone along with the beach marks and ratchet steps and the rapid final fracture zone. Stress analysis shows that the amount of pre-tightening selected lower than the proposed value leads to the joint loosening and shortens the bolt’ s fatigue life. In addition, based on the paper results, the existing flowchart for component fabrication is analyzed and a flowchart based on research field is presented to enhance the quality of radial forging machine parts.

The robustness of steel joints in fire is important for steel building structures because of the need to prevent progressive collapse. Stainless steel is widely used in building construction mainly because of its corrosion resistance, but it also possesses improved fire resistance compared with conventional non-alloy, fine grain structural steels. Extensive research performed on the robustness of steel joints in fire has revealed that failure at elevated temperature may be controlled by bolt shear for fin plate and web cleat connections. Hence, this study focussed on the use of stainless steel in experimental tests conducted on fin plate and web cleat connections at high temperatures. In addition, this study investigated the use of a component-based model to predict connection performance at elevated temperature.

با افزایش روزافزون نیازهای کاربران شبکه در عصر حاضر، تکنولوژی های دسترسی پهن باند موجود، قادر به پاسخگوی نیازهای کاربران نمی باشند. به عبارت دیگر، تعدد نیاز به تبدیل پروتکل ها در حد فاصل میان کاربران و شبکه های عمومی، که مایل اول نیز خوانده می شود، کارایی شبکه ها را به صورت قابل ملاحظه ای کاهش داده است. استاندارد(Ethernet in the First Mile) EFM  با هدف رفع این مشکل از طریق گسترش کاربرد اترنت از سطح شبکه های محلی به سطح شبکه های دسترسی معرفی شده است. بنابراین، با استفاده از  EFMنیاز به تبدیل پروتکل مرتفع خواهد شد. این مقاله در حقیقت به عنوان یک مرحله مهم برای استفاده از EFM در زندگی روزمره بشمار می رود. به عبارت دیگر، هدف از این مقاله، معرفی پیاده سازی سخت افزاری زیرلایه TC از استاندارد EFM با استفاده از قابلیت های موازی سازی آن می باشد. نتایج آزمایش ها نشان می دهد که پیاده سازی سخت افزاری ماجول TC- Encapsulation شرایط مناسبی را برای استفاده از EFM به صورت وسیع ایجاد می کند.
